I can’t believe I didn’t discover this sooner, but the folks who brought us the Lizzie Bennet Diaries have returned with a new web series based on Jane Austen’s Emma! It’s called Emma Approved, and it is pretty freakin’ adorable! Here’s Episode 1:

Yes, Emma’s self-confidence is grating and borderline crazy, but that’s part of her charm! Subsequent videos reveal that while she is incredibly determined and doesn’t take no for an answer, she also really cares about her friends and wants them to be happy. So far I’m really enjoying this adaptation, and I can’t wait to see what happens next! Videos are posted Mondays and Thursdays, and there’s still plenty of time to catch up! 🙂
